ROYAL Caribbean’s Anthem of the Seas and Quantum of the Seas will cruise from Sydney and Brisbane respectively in 2026-2027, the line has announced.
The pair will sail a combination of three- to 11-night getaways to an array of destinations across Australia, the South Pacific, and New Zealand between Oct 2026 and Apr 2027.
The new cruises are available to book now, with passengers able to sail from Sydney on two four-night getaways to Hobart, or venture further to discover the South Pacific.
There are also all-new nine-night NZ getaways to destinations like Wellington, Napier, Dunedin, and Milford Sound.
The season will kick off with a 25-night cruise from Los Angeles to Sydney, visiting Hawai’i, French Polynesia, and Catalina Island.
Quantum will also make her comeback to Brisbane in Oct for her fourth year as the largest ship in the region.
Sun-seekers can choose from 28 holidays ranging from three to eight nights, exploring the South Pacific across destinations such as Noumea and Vanuatu.
The season will feature two eight-night tropical getaways over Christmas and the New Year, while cruisers can also choose from four- to seven-night Queensland coast cruises to Airlie Beach and Cairns.
The 4,200-passenger ship’s 2026-27 line-up will also feature more seven-night getaways departing over the weekend.
